Death Cab for Cutie – Little Boxes (Malvina Reynolds cover) Lyrics 15 years ago
Wow, I didn't even know they covered this.

The original song was written in the "Levittown" era, when mass-produced housing started popping up on every hillside. The song was basically mocking/complaining about that.
